Chapter 80 - REDUCTION OF TOXICS IN PACKAGING
Section 096-80-5 - CERTIFICATE OF COMPLIANCE

Current through 2024-13, March 27, 2024

After September 30, 1993, a certificate of compliance conforming to the form attached as Exhibit I and stating that a package or packaging components is in compliance with standards established in Section 4 shall be furnished by its manufacturer to the agency. A certificate of compliance may cover more than one type of package or packaging component as long as each type is identified separately. The certificate of compliance shall be signed by an authorized official of the manufacturing company. If requested, test results shall be made available to the agency to verify information provided in a certificate of compliance.

A. New or reformulated packaging. If the manufacturer reformulates or creates a new package or packaging component, the manufacturer shall provide the agency with an amended or new certificate of compliance for the reformulated or new package or packaging component.

B. Presentation of certificates. Each manufacturer shall furnish the agency with an original certificate of compliance and each manufacturer or supplier shall furnish, at the agency's request, copies of a certificate of compliance for distribution to the public.
